Early Career and Rookie Season
Let's rewind a bit and take a look at the beginning of RJ Barrett's NBA journey. Selected as the third overall pick in the 2019 NBA draft by the New York Knicks, the expectations were sky-high for this young Canadian. His rookie season was a mixed bag, filled with flashes of brilliance and the inevitable struggles that come with adjusting to the professional level.
During his rookie campaign, RJ Barrett's stats were a decent showing of what he could achieve. He showcased his scoring ability, driving skills, and potential to become a key player for the Knicks. Though there were moments of inconsistency, it was clear that he possessed a unique blend of skills that could make him a force in the league.
